Rhydon is a formidable Ground/Rock type Pokémon, first introduced in Generation I as number 112 in the National Pokédex. It stands as the evolved form of Rhyhorn, showcasing a more bipedal and heavily armored appearance. Its powerful drill horn is a defining characteristic, used to bore through solid rock and even shatter diamonds. Rhydon is known for its immense physical strength and durability, making it a powerful presence in battles. In the anime, it has been featured as a reliable companion for trainers like Giovanni and Blaine, often demonstrating its destructive capabilities. Its habitat typically includes rocky terrains, mountains, and caves, where it can utilize its drilling abilities. Rhydon's diet likely consists of minerals and rocks, which contribute to its tough hide. Its evolution, Rhyperior, was introduced in Generation IV, further cementing Rhydon's place in a significant evolutionary line. As a Ground/Rock type, Rhydon has a unique set of type matchups, being strong against Fire, Electric, Flying, Bug, Ice, but vulnerable to Water, Grass, Fighting, Ground, and Steel attacks. Its role in the games often involves being a tanky physical attacker, capable of dishing out and withstanding considerable damage.
